When developing a residential landscape, the most vital action is to put an intend on paper. Establishing a master plan will certainly conserve you money and time and is more probable to cause an effective style. A master plan is developed with the 'layout procedure': a detailed approach that takes into consideration the environmental conditions, your wishes, and the elements and principles of style.

The 5 steps of the design process include: 1) performing a site inventory and analysis, 2) determining your demands, 3) producing functional representations, 4) establishing theoretical design plans, and 5) drawing a last layout plan. The very first three actions develop the aesthetic, functional, and gardening demands for the layout. The last 2 actions after that use those needs to the creation of the final landscape plan.

The kind of dirt identifies the nutrients and moisture readily available to the plants. It is constantly best to make use of plants that will certainly thrive in the existing soil. Dirt can be changed, amendment is frequently costly and many times inefficient. Existing greenery can supply hints to the dirt type. Where plants grow well, note the dirt problems and use plants with similar expanding demands.

Topography and water drainage ought to also be noted and all drainage troubles dealt with in the suggested layout. A great style will certainly relocate water far from your house and re-route it to other locations of the lawn. Climate issues begin with temperature: plants should have the ability to survive the average high and, most significantly, the typical low temperatures for the area.


Sun/shade patterns, the amount and size of exposure to sun or shade (Figure 1), create microclimates (occasionally called microhabitats). Recording website conditions and existing greenery on a base map will reveal the area of microclimates in the lawn. Plants normally fall under a couple of of four microclimate categories-full sunlight, partial shade, color, and deep shade.




Utilities such as power lines, septic containers, below ground energies and roofing system overhangs figure out plant place. Make use of a land surveyor's plat of your property for the limits and place of your home.

This is called "local color", which implies it fits with the surroundings. There are both form themes and design motifs. Every garden should have a form style, however not all gardens have a design motif. Many domestic gardens have no specific style other than to blend with the home by repeating details from the style such as products, color, and form (Landscapers).


In a form motif the company and shape of the areas in the lawn is based either on the shape of the home, the shape of the locations in between your home and the home borders, or a favorite form of the homeowner. The type theme determines the shape and organization (the layout) of the areas and the web links in between them.
